Question 1: What visual cue indicates that fat has been properly cut into flour for a flaky pie crust?
- The mixture looks like fine sand
- The mixture resembles pea-sized pieces with some coarser bits (Correct answer)
- The mixture is completely smooth and uniform
- The mixture turns slightly yellow
Correct answer: The mixture resembles pea-sized pieces with some coarser bits
Pea-sized fat pieces dispersed through flour create the steam pockets that produce flaky layers during baking.
Question 2: Why should pie dough rest in the refrigerator before rolling?
- To firm up the fat and allow gluten to relax (Correct answer)
- To allow the yeast to activate
- To increase the dough's sweetness
- To dry out excess moisture
Correct answer: To firm up the fat and allow gluten to relax
Resting firms the fat back up after handling and allows gluten strands to relax, preventing shrinkage during rolling and baking.
Question 3: When a recipe calls for 'rubbing' fat into flour by hand, what technique minimizes heat transfer?
- Using your palms to press the fat in firmly
- Using just your fingertips in a quick, light motion (Correct answer)
- Squeezing the mixture in your fists repeatedly
- Mixing with your whole hand submerged in the flour
Correct answer: Using just your fingertips in a quick, light motion
Using only fingertips minimizes contact area and time, keeping body heat from melting the fat.
Question 4: What problem does docking (pricking) a pie crust solve?
- Prevents the crust from shrinking on the sides
- Prevents steam bubbles from puffing the crust up during blind baking (Correct answer)
- Helps the egg wash adhere better
- Allows the filling to bond with the crust
Correct answer: Prevents steam bubbles from puffing the crust up during blind baking
Docking creates small holes that allow steam to escape, preventing the crust bottom from bubbling or lifting during baking.
Question 5: Which mixing method results in a mealy (crumbly, less flaky) pie crust texture?
- Cutting fat into flour until only pea-sized pieces remain
- Blending fat into flour until it resembles coarse cornmeal (Correct answer)
- Freezing the fat before use
- Adding ice water all at once
Correct answer: Blending fat into flour until it resembles coarse cornmeal
When fat is worked into flour more completely (coarse-meal stage), it coats flour particles and produces a crumbly, mealy texture ideal for bottom crusts holding wet fillings.
Question 6: What is the 'fraisage' technique in pie crust making?
- Rolling the dough out on a floured marble slab
- Smearing the dough across the work surface with the heel of the hand to distribute fat (Correct answer)
- Chilling the dough between two sheets of parchment
- Folding the dough multiple times like puff pastry
Correct answer: Smearing the dough across the work surface with the heel of the hand to distribute fat
Fraisage is a French technique of smearing dough with the heel of the hand to evenly distribute fat without overworking the gluten.
Question 7: If a pie crust shrinks significantly during baking, what is the most likely cause?
- Too much fat was used
- Insufficient resting time allowed gluten tension to remain in the dough (Correct answer)
- The oven temperature was too low
- Too much sugar was added to the dough
Correct answer: Insufficient resting time allowed gluten tension to remain in the dough
Overstretched, unrelaxed gluten springs back during baking; resting lets gluten relax so the crust holds its shape.
